#define FT5406_DEVICE_MODE 0
#define FT5406_GESTURE_ID 1
#define FT5406_NUM_POINTS 2
#define FT5406_POINT_XH(n) (0 + 3 + (n)*6)
#define FT5406_POINT_XL(n) (1 + 3 + (n)*6)
#define FT5406_POINT_YH(n) (2 + 3 + (n)*6)
#define FT5406_POINT_YL(n) (3 + 3 + (n)*6)
#define FT5406_WINDOW_SIZE 64
#define GET_NUM_POINTS(buf) (buf[FT5406_NUM_POINTS])
#define GET_X(buf, n) (((buf[FT5406_POINT_XH(n)] & 0xf) << 8) | \
(buf[FT5406_POINT_XL(n)]))
#define GET_Y(buf, n) (((buf[FT5406_POINT_YH(n)] & 0xf) << 8) | \
(buf[FT5406_POINT_YL(n)]))
#define GET_TOUCH_ID(buf, n) ((buf[FT5406_POINT_YH(n)] >> 4) & 0xf)
#define NO_POINTS 99
#define SCREEN_WIDTH 800
#define SCREEN_HEIGHT 480
struct ft5406ts_softc {
device_t sc_dev;
struct mtx sc_mtx;
struct proc *sc_worker;
/* mbox buffer (mapped to KVA) */
uint8_t *touch_buf;
/* initial hook for waiting mbox intr */
struct intr_config_hook sc_init_hook;
struct evdev_dev *sc_evdev;
int sc_detaching;
};
static void
ft5406ts_worker(void *data)
{
struct ft5406ts_softc *sc = (struct ft5406ts_softc *)data;
int points;
int id, new_x, new_y, i, new_pen_down, updated;
int x, y, pen_down;
uint8_t window[FT5406_WINDOW_SIZE];
int tick;
/* 60Hz */
tick = hz*17/1000;
if (tick == 0)
tick = 1;
x = y = -1;
pen_down = 0;
FT5406_LOCK(sc);
while(1) {
msleep(sc, &sc->sc_mtx, PCATCH | PZERO, "ft5406ts", tick);
if (sc->sc_detaching)
break;
memcpy(window, sc->touch_buf, sizeof(window));
sc->touch_buf[FT5406_NUM_POINTS] = NO_POINTS;
points = GET_NUM_POINTS(window);
/*
* No update from VC - do nothing
*/
if (points == NO_POINTS)
continue;
/* No points and pen is already up */
if ((points == 0) && !pen_down)
continue;
new_pen_down = 0;
for (i = 0; i < points; i++) {
id = GET_TOUCH_ID(window, 0);
/* For now consider only touch 0 */
if (id != 0)
continue;
new_pen_down = 1;
new_x = GET_X(window, 0);
new_y = GET_Y(window, 0);
}
updated = 0;
if (new_x != x) {
x = new_x;
updated = 1;
}
if (new_y != y) {
y = new_y;
updated = 1;
}
if (new_pen_down != pen_down) {
pen_down = new_pen_down;
updated = 1;
}
if (updated) {
evdev_push_event(sc->sc_evdev, EV_ABS, ABS_X, x);
evdev_push_event(sc->sc_evdev, EV_ABS, ABS_Y, y);
evdev_push_event(sc->sc_evdev, EV_KEY, BTN_TOUCH, pen_down);
evdev_sync(sc->sc_evdev);
}
}
FT5406_UNLOCK(sc);
kproc_exit(0);
}
static void
ft5406ts_init(void *arg)
{
struct ft5406ts_softc *sc = arg;
struct bcm2835_mbox_tag_touchbuf msg;
uint32_t touchbuf;
int err;
/* release this hook (continue boot) */
config_intrhook_disestablish(&sc->sc_init_hook);
memset(&msg, 0, sizeof(msg));
msg.hdr.buf_size = sizeof(msg);
msg.hdr.code = BCM2835_MBOX_CODE_REQ;
msg.tag_hdr.tag = BCM2835_MBOX_TAG_GET_TOUCHBUF;
msg.tag_hdr.val_buf_size = sizeof(msg.body);
msg.tag_hdr.val_len = sizeof(msg.body);
msg.end_tag = 0;
/* call mailbox property */
err = bcm2835_mbox_property(&msg, sizeof(msg));
if (err) {
device_printf(sc->sc_dev, "failed to get touchbuf address\n");
return;
}
if (msg.body.resp.address == 0) {
device_printf(sc->sc_dev, "touchscreen not detected\n");
return;
}
touchbuf = VCBUS_TO_PHYS(msg.body.resp.address);
sc->touch_buf = (uint8_t*)pmap_mapdev(touchbuf, FT5406_WINDOW_SIZE);
sc->sc_evdev = evdev_alloc();
evdev_set_name(sc->sc_evdev, device_get_desc(sc->sc_dev));
evdev_set_phys(sc->sc_evdev, device_get_nameunit(sc->sc_dev));
evdev_set_id(sc->sc_evdev, BUS_VIRTUAL, 0, 0, 0);
evdev_support_prop(sc->sc_evdev, INPUT_PROP_DIRECT);
evdev_support_event(sc->sc_evdev, EV_SYN);
evdev_support_event(sc->sc_evdev, EV_ABS);
evdev_support_event(sc->sc_evdev, EV_KEY);
evdev_support_abs(sc->sc_evdev, ABS_X, 0, 0,
SCREEN_WIDTH, 0, 0, 0);
evdev_support_abs(sc->sc_evdev, ABS_Y, 0, 0,
SCREEN_HEIGHT, 0, 0, 0);
evdev_support_key(sc->sc_evdev, BTN_TOUCH);
err = evdev_register(sc->sc_evdev);
if (err) {
evdev_free(sc->sc_evdev);
return;
}
sc->touch_buf[FT5406_NUM_POINTS] = NO_POINTS;
if (kproc_create(ft5406ts_worker, (void*)sc, &sc->sc_worker, 0, 0,
"ft5406ts_worker") != 0) {
printf("failed to create ft5406ts_worker\n");
}
}
